raveling the world is an exciting adventure, but safety should always be a top priority. While every country has its risks, some destinations pose significant dangers due to crime, political instability, conflict, or natural disasters. Here are ten of the most dangerous countries to visit in 2024.
1. Afghanistan
Afghanistan remains one of the most dangerous places for travelers due to ongoing conflict, terrorism, and political instability. The presence of militant groups and the lack of law enforcement make it highly unsafe for visitors.
2. Syria
Years of civil war have left Syria in turmoil, with frequent bombings, kidnappings, and military operations. The risk of terrorist attacks and violent crime makes it one of the least recommended destinations.
3. Yemen
Yemen is suffering from a severe humanitarian crisis, ongoing war, and a lack of basic resources. Kidnappings, armed conflicts, and disease outbreaks make it an extremely high-risk country for travelers.
4. South Sudan
Political instability and violent conflicts continue to plague South Sudan. Ethnic tensions, armed groups, and crime rates remain dangerously high, making it one of the riskiest places to visit.
5. Somalia
Somalia is known for high levels of piracy, terrorism, and crime. The lack of a stable government and the presence of armed militias make it a highly unsafe destination.
6. Central African Republic
The Central African Republic is affected by armed conflict, political instability, and violent crime. The country lacks infrastructure and medical services, making it a dangerous place for tourists.
7. Democratic Republic of the Congo
Despite its natural beauty, the DRC faces ongoing violence, armed conflicts, and extreme poverty. The risk of kidnapping, armed attacks, and disease outbreaks make it unsafe for travelers.
8. Venezuela
Venezuela has been struggling with economic collapse, political unrest, and high crime rates. Kidnappings, robberies, and violent protests are common, making it one of the most dangerous places in South America.
9. Haiti
Haiti is dealing with high levels of gang violence, political instability, and extreme poverty. Crime rates, including armed robberies and kidnappings, make it an unsafe destination for tourists.
10. North Korea
Although North Korea is not known for violent crime, strict government control and the risk of imprisonment for violating local laws make it a risky destination. Travelers have been detained for minor offenses, facing harsh consequences.
